    I come here more than I'd like to admit, and not just out of convenience. I really love their Baked Potato, which I get fully loaded with either pulled pork or brisket. And they have one of the best cheeseburgers around. I've always had great customer service, whether I'm sitting in the dining section or the bar area. They have fun events and live music (worth giving a follow on social). But one of the most telling things, to me, is the regulars. In my opinion, a business with customers as frequent and loyal as I've seen has to be doing something right. Here, after a while, you get greeted by name, they remember your regular order, and give service with a friendly conversation. It's nice. Ask for their spicy habanero bbq sauce :) it's amazing with just the right amount of heat. The atmosphere is hometown casual, counter order for the dining area, but you can order at the bar, too, and I've always had excellent service. It's family-owned and operated and, selfishly, I'd like to see them in this location for a long, long time!
